Muchachos (en. Boys)

muˈt͡ʃat͡ʃos

Meaning & Definition

EnglishSpanish
noun
A term that refers to a group of young people or children.
The boys play in the park.
Los muchachos juegan en el parque.
A colloquial way of referring to friends or companions.
I went out with my boys over the weekend.
Salí con mis muchachos el fin de semana.
It can also refer to males in general in informal contexts.
Those boys are very active.
Esos muchachos son muy activos.

Common Phrases and Expressions

good boys
It refers to a group of young people who behave positively.
muchachos buenos
street boys
A term used to refer to young people who live on the street or belong to a specific informal group.
muchachos de la calle
the boys and the girls
An expression that includes both young males and young females.
los muchachos y las muchachas

Slang Meanings

Close friends.
I'm going out with the boys tonight.
Voy a salir con los muchachos esta noche.
A group that engages in a specific activity.
The neighborhood boys always do something fun.
Los muchachos del barrio siempre hacen algo divertido.
A term of endearment or friendliness to refer to a group of guys.
I always trust my boys.
Siempre confío en mis muchachos.
